Short Story competitions now open for submissions

26th January 2022 Denise Baden Uncategorised

We are running two competitions. One for adults (deadline 21st Feb 2022) and one for 11-18 year olds (deadline 3rd March 2022). Check out entry requirements early as we ask for a little pre-reading. We ask for stories between 2000 and 5000 words that include green solutions. Prize of £200 for each winner.
